Detailed Itinerary
Day 1 UNESCO World Heritage Sites in Kathmandu Valley (Kathmandu Durbar Square, Swayambhunath Stupa, Boudhanath Stupa, Pashupatinath Temple)
Pashupatinath Temple is regarded as the biggest Hindu temple in Nepal
Today you will visit 4 well-known world heritage sites in Kathmandu. Start the trip with a visit to Pashupatinath, which lies around 5 km northeast of Kathmandu. Your next destination is one of the holy Buddhist sites of Nepal, Boudhanath. The biggest stupa in Nepal, Boudhanath, is the center of Tibetan Buddhism. Further, you will visit the Kathmandu Durbar Square and finally conclude the day with a visit to Swayambhunath Stupa atop a hill.
Overnight in Kathmandu.
Day 2 Nagarkot Sunrise view in the morning, hike to Changunarayan, then drive to Kathmandu
Changunarayan Temple - a UNESCO world heritage site in Nepal
You will begin the day with a short drive from your hotel at around 4:30 am to admire mesmerizing sunrise from Nagarkot viewpoint. Nagarkot is a popular hill station in Nepal situated at an altitude of 2,175m. Next, we hike to Changunarayan for about 4-5 hours. The hiking trail passes through Telkot village, inhabited by Tamang and Newari communities. You will reach the hilltop temple of Changunarayan, a UNESCO world heritage site in Nepal. After exploring the ancient temple, you will take a drive from Changunarayan to Kathmandu.
Overnight in Kathmandu.
